Nailing Schedule for Balloon Framing: A Comprehensive Guide

Balloon framing is a traditional construction method known for its use of long, continuous studs that extend from the foundation to the roofline. To ensure the structural integrity and stability of balloon-framed buildings, it’s essential to follow a specific nailing schedule. In this article, we’ll provide clear and concise guidance on the nailing schedule for balloon framing, suitable for both technical experts and those new to construction.

1. Stud Spacing and Layout

Balloon framing relies on a consistent spacing of vertical studs that run from the foundation to the roof. Standard stud spacing for balloon framing is typically 24 inches on center, though it can vary depending on the design and local building codes. It’s crucial to ensure that studs are precisely aligned, plumb, and evenly spaced to maintain structural integrity.

2. Nailing Pattern

The nailing pattern for balloon framing is critical for the stability of the structure. The most common nailing pattern involves:

a. Base Plate to Foundation: At the base of the wall, secure the bottom plate to the foundation using anchor bolts. The recommended spacing for anchor bolts is 4 to 6 feet.

b. Studs to Bottom Plate: Attach each stud to the bottom plate using two 16d common nails. These nails should be evenly spaced along the height of the stud. This provides a solid connection.

c. Top Plate to Studs: Secure the top plate to the upper ends of the studs using two 16d common nails for each connection point. Again, ensure even spacing and a secure attachment.

d. Studs to Rim Joist: For additional stability, connect the studs to the rim joist, which is a horizontal framing member running along the top of the foundation. Use two 16d common nails per stud.

3. Nailing Safety

Safety is a top priority when using nail guns in balloon framing. Follow these safety guidelines:

a. Wear Appropriate Safety Gear: Always wear safety glasses, hearing protection, and gloves when operating a nail gun.

b. Check Nail Gun Functionality: Regularly inspect and maintain your nail gun to ensure it functions correctly.

c. Mind the Angle: Ensure that nails are driven perpendicular to the surface to prevent splitting and maximize strength.

4. Common Mistakes to Avoid

Avoid these common errors when implementing a nailing schedule for balloon framing:

a. Inadequate Fasteners: Make sure to use the recommended nail size and type for each connection point to maintain the required strength.

b. Incorrect Nailing Spacing: Deviating from the recommended nailing spacing can lead to structural instability.

c. Improper Alignment: Precise alignment of studs, plates, and joists is essential for the stability of the structure.
